How Big Is a 20 Yard Dumpster?

The 20 yard dumpster size runs roughly 22 feet long, 7.5 feet wide, and 4.5 feet tall, and those 20 yard dumpster measurements are what most people mean when they ask about dumpster dimensions 20 yard. That footprint fits most driveways in Omaha, but you still need clearance. Omaha Porta Pros asks for about 60 feet of straight clearance behind the delivery truck so the driver can set the container down without backing across the yard. If your driveway curves or sits behind a gate, check dumpster sizes and dimensions before you book, and compare against the 10 yard dumpster rental if your space is tight. What Can Go In a 20 Yard Dumpster?

For a 20 yard trash dumpster, shingles, drywall, lumber, old fencing, flooring, and general construction debris all work fine. What doesn't: tires, batteries, paint cans, and anything flagged on our what cannot go in a dumpster page. Weight matters as much as volume with this size. A 20 yard container fills up fast with heavy material like shingles or concrete, so check dumpster weight limits before you load it to the rim, since overage fees can wipe out any savings from renting the smaller size. Do I Need a Permit for a 20 Yard Dumpster in Omaha?

It depends on where the container sits. If it stays on your own driveway or a private lot, most Omaha projects don't need anything from the city. If it has to sit in the street or right-of-way, that placement needs confirming with the city before delivery. Rules vary by block and by how long the container stays, so don't assume. Our dumpster permit requirements page covers what to ask when you call, and construction dumpster rental has more on job-site placement if you're running a larger crew. Omaha inspectors do check active sites, so it's worth the five-minute phone call rather than a stop-work order mid-project.
